Single-Band, Semi-Board Band Antenna Distribution Module for sound bag, cart and trolley applications.
Diversity Antenna Distribution Module DADM226-MK2-SB is a custom design, which offers the solution to antenna and power distribution requirements for portable sound bag applications. Designed for where the weight and size matter without sacrificing performance.
The DADM226-MK2 is a 2 IN and 2 x 6 OUT active antenna distribution system with custom-tuned band-pass filtering; user-adjustable system gain, the DADM226-MK2 eliminates multiple receiver antennas and provides a tidy sound bag solution with improved RF performance.
There are two industry-standard BNC input connectors for antenna inputs that enable the use of standard low loss RF extension cables, and there are 2 x 6 mini-RF SMA connectors feeding to the diversity receivers.
In applications when remote antenna power is needed, the DADM offers switchable Active Antenna powering (MHA powering) with RED LEDs indicating power ON/OFF status, the MHA powering can be turned ON/OFF through the OLED display menu.
The DADM226-MK2 has a very high input signal handling capacity with a very low noise figure and offers an outstanding inter-modulation performance when compared to other low power devices available.
The DADM is externally powered between 10-18Vdc, the dc input connector is an industry-standard 4-pin Hirose and there are 6 x Hirose dc output connectors available for powering any auxiliary equipment in any sound bag. Each dc output port can be individually turned ON/OFF through the OLED menu.
A green LED indicates the power-on status of the system box and the OLED display continuously displays dc input voltage.
Powering for the multiple receivers can be powered through the DC Hirose output sockets. The dc output ports can be turned ON/OFF from the OLED display menu.

| RF Distribution Section | |
| Frequency Range | 470 to 1154MHz (in bands) |
| Input Impedance | 50 Ω |
| Output Impedance | 50 Ω |
| Gain (each output) |
+6 dB to -10dB, user-adjustable in 1dB steps
|
| Current Consumption | 180mA @12.0V dc |
| UHF Bandpass Type | |
| Available Bands to order |
470-1154MHz (please see drop down Menu)
|
| OIP3 | > +41dBm |
| Port to port isolation | > 20dB (min.) |
| Noise figure | < 3 dB |
| Connections | |
| RF Inputs | 2x50 Ω Standard BNC Sockets |
| RF outputs | 12x50 Ω mini UHF SMA sockets |
| DC Power IN | 4-pin Hirose (compatible) socket fused and protected against reverse polarity |
| DC Power OUT | 6x4-pin Hirose (compatible) sockets individually under user control, protected against reverse polarity |
| Main ON/OFF Switch | Master Toggle switch |
| DC IN pinouts | Pin1+2(-ve) and Pin4+3(+ve) |
| DC OUT pinouts | Pin1(-ve) and Pin4(+ve) |
| Powering | |
| Operating Voltage Range | 10-18V dc |
| Remote Antenna Powering | Switchable dc T-bias powering, 12Vdc @ 250mA max, regulated for active antenna powering, short circuit protected |
| Hirose dc output |
Unregulated incoming volts, switched under user control
|
| Total Current Distribution | 3A (max.) |
| Outer Case | |
| Dimensions | 192x69x35mm (LxWxH) |
| Weight | 415g |
